FIELD: measuring.
SUBSTANCE: invention relates to measurement equipment and can be used in surveillance and sector radioelectronic equipment (REE) for solving problems in the interest of ensuring electromagnetic compatibility. Technical result is achieved due to continuous analysis of the estimated value of the unintentional interference effect, which shows how many times the REE reception threshold should be increased in conditions of interference, in order to maintain probability of false alarm at the same level. Identifying the source of the UI originator for taking measures aimed at ensuring EMC, in agreement with the services.
EFFECT: preservation of maximum range of detection of aerial objects of radio-electronic equipment due to preservation of value of probability of false alarms in conditions of unintentional interference (UI).
